Kevin Andrews-An Appraisal

April 2011
Anthony J Papalas is Professor of Greek and Roman History at the University of East Carolina; he is the author of books on Ikaria and a man whose views I respect. In the latest issue of the Journal of the Hellenic Diaspora, Anthony gives an appraisal of Kevin Andrews. Quoting from Andrews, Paddy Leigh-Fermor, Glenn Bugh, myself and others he offers a critical overview of the life and works of Kevin Andrews. His conclusion is clearly stated:

For Andrews writing was a journal of self-discovery and in the process he produced works of great literature.
